NYC School Construction Authority (NYCSCA)
Mentor Program
Description
The NYCSCA seeks to increase, facilitate and encourage the participation of minority-owned, women-owned and locally based enterprise (MWLBE) firms by providing a flexible framework for eligible firms to develop and grow within the construction industry and to establish long-term business relationships with the NYCSCA.
A key component of the program is that it targets smaller construction contracts – valued up to $750,000 – for mentor program participants to bid against each other. The firm that is deemed the lowest, most responsible and responsive is awarded the contract. The awarded mentor firm is then contacted by the assigned Scope a Mentor CM firm to oversee and provide them with technical assistance in the field, while completing the project. The NYCSCA hires construction managers not only to ensure that all projects are completed safely, on time and within budget, but also to mentor and provide technical assistance to participating firms.
Scope of Services Provided
NobleStrategy Construction Management team has assisted the NYCSCA with their projects having completed over 500 projects in 350 schools under consecutive contracts since 2007. As Construction Managers, NobleStrategy has provided technical assistance, preconstruction, cost control, scheduling, procurement, construction monitoring and administration, safety management and project close-out to the of the various projects.
